| September 14th | SoHo Apartment Building | 5:30pm

Settling down to review the data package you collected from the meet you find the following

1. A copy of a document signed by one Duke Torres and witnessed by Simon Rubin, Attorney-at-law. The document effectively agrees that for a commute of the death penalty to something more lenient Duke will disclose all he knows on the operations of the Blood Rose gang.

2. Internal documents (NYPD) to the Roosevelt prison governor confirming the transfer of Duke to their care for 72hours hours questioning on Sept 16th with questioning set to begin on 17th at 10AM

3. Duty Roster sheet. Suggesting there will be the following effecting the transfer : 1 Driver for Van, 1 Guard, 2 motorcycle outriders, 1 pursuit driver and backup.

4. Plan of route from the prison to the facility on 54th street.

5. Tactical analysis of transfer stating risk is moderate to high should the blood rose gang learn of the transfer,however it notes an over night transfer taking place at a random point determined no more than 1 hour before 9pm should provide minimum exposure to escort. It discusses backup strategy for any attack : 1 NYD chopper with drone assistance will be on standby - from go command the chopper will be on site within 22 mins.

Its clear that the information you have is detailed enough to give you an idea of when, where and how as well as the firepower you will be facing.
